Here is an extensive take a look at why you need to clean your restroom drains monthly:
1. Avoid Blockages
Among the most apparent reasons for cleaning your restroom drains pipes each month is to prevent clogs. A lot more goes down the drain than you would think-- skin flakes, eyelashes, dirt, and hair. All of these particles build up and ultimately trigger clogs. Even a small clog can make your sink or shower essentially unusable. When you clean your drains pipes regularly, you will not end up with deep blockages that need strong chemicals and professional equipment. While you can clean your bathroom drains by yourself, we advise that you call a plumbing professional to professionally clean your drains a couple of times each year.
2. Avoid Bad Odors
A expert plumber can not just unclog your drain however also ventilate it. You can pour hot water and bleach down the drain to get rid of some of the bad smells, but that is just a short-term repair.
3. Identify Underlying Issues
When you tidy your drain once a month, you can recognize underlying concerns prior to they end up being major issues. For example, if you notice particles coming out of your bathroom drains pipes with a snake cleaner, they could be rusting. Any irregular items coming out of a drain should raise issues. If it is not just the regular hair and gunk, you ought to get in touch with a plumbing technician to see if your restroom drains need to be fixed.
4. Faster Draining
Do you hate the sensation of standing in a number of inches of water in the shower? A slow-draining sink or shower is a excellent sign that you need to clean the pipes. When you tidy your drains monthly, you ought to never have to worry about slow-draining sinks or showers. Not only that, but faster-draining pipes help keep your sink and shower cleaner.
5. Prevent Substantial Damage
As pointed out, routinely cleaning your restroom drains pipes can assist determine underlying concerns that are more severe than a sink blocked with hair. The average expense to fix a drain line is $696, which is far more pricey than the simple $10 it takes to clean your drains regular monthly. Major clogs can damage your whole pipes system and even have an effect on the public systems and the quality of water.

You need to routinely inspect the pilot light for extreme soot accumulation if you have a gas water heating system. Excessive soot accumulation can cause a clogged up flue, which can result in carbon monoxide gas leaking into your house. Therefore, a regular check up of the pilot burner is very important in making sure there isn't a buildup of soot.
Get rid of odors in your waste-disposal unit. In most cases' odors in your waste-disposal system might not be a sign of a obstruction, but just little food particles that have begun to rot. Place a mix of lemon peel and ice cubes in the system, and run it for about a minute. Follow this with a great amount of cold water. Attempt a degrease or specialized waste disposal cleaner if this doesn't help.
Make sure that you prevent tossing fats down the drain after you clean up your meal. Fats can solidify with time which can trigger a drain issue and corrupt your water flow. Toss out fats and various types of cooking oils in the garbage after you finish with your meal.
To get rid of dirt that builds up under the edges of faucets, consider utilizing an old tooth brush, instead of cleaning products. Lots of cleansing products will just trigger damage to your faucets, and a few of this damage could be severe. Just dip the toothbrush into warm water and after that utilize it.

Waste disposal unit are a typical reason for pipes problems, which is an easy issue to resolve. Don't simply put everything down the disposal or treat it like a second wastebasket. Utilize the disposal things that would be challenging to get rid of usually. Putting all leftover food down the sink is a excellent way to produce blockages.
Make certain to never leave any combustible liquids near your hot water heater. Certain liquids like gasoline, solvents, or adhesives are flammable, and if left too near to the hot water heater, can ignite. Location it far away from your water heater if you have to have these liquids in your basement.
